    Hey all, im new here so help me out if you will.
    I got a white 3.4l extended cab. Im looking to buy a new exhaust system, but have no idea what direction to go in. I would love dual, but from what i hear its just for show and has no actual practicality. Any information would be great, mainly i would like to know the pros and cons of the different types and brands. Thanks!, Matt

    Just weld in a dynomax super turbo part # 17748 and chop off the tailpipe just past the axle. No need for a catback, waste of money unless yours is rusted through.
